49Transitional provisionU.K.
(1)In relation to offences committed before [F12 May 2022], the reference in section 10(5)(b) to 12 months is to be read as a reference to 6 months.
(2)In relation to offences committed before section 85(1) of the Legal Aid, Sentencing and Punishment of Offenders Act 2012 comes into force—
(a)the reference in section 10(5)(b) to a fine is to be read as a reference to a fine not exceeding the statutory maximum;
(b)paragraph 15(3)(b) of Schedule 1 has effect as if the words “in Scotland or Northern Ireland” were omitted.
(3)The amendments made by subsections (3) and (4) of section 17 apply only to things done and offences committed after that section comes into force.
(4)A reference to a calendar year in the following subsections does not include a year before 2016—
(a)subsection (3) of section 44;
(b)subsection (4C) of section 36 of the Terrorism Act 2006 (inserted by section 45(1) above);
F2(c). .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.
(d)subsection (2) of section 20 of the Terrorism Prevention and Investigation Measures Act 2011 (substituted by section 45(3) above).
